cancellate

Betekenis (Engels)

  1. Consisting of a network of veins, without intermediate parenchyma; lattice-like.
  2. Having the surface covered with raised lines, crossing at right angles.
  3. Cancellated.

Etimologie (Engels)

From Latin cancellatus, past participle of cancellare.
